Director, Engineering – New Energy Systems

Energy Vault is a global energy storage and power infrastructure company focused on delivering reliable and flexible power solutions. The Director, Engineering of New Energy Systems will lead the development and commercialization of next-generation energy systems, driving technical strategy and system architecture from concept through deployment.

Responsibilities

Lead engineering development of New Energy Systems with particular focus on hydrogen-based systems, including:
Electrolysis (PEM, alkaline, or SOEC)
Hydrogen storage (compressed gas, liquid hydrogen, or novel storage media)
Fuel cell (PEM, SOFC, or hybrid configurations), linear generators, nuclear, and thermal generators
Balance-of-plant (compression, purification, thermal management, controls)
Drive the New Energy Systems roadmap, guiding technology from concept through demonstration and commercial deployment
Evaluate emerging generation technologies and products for integration into the company’s solution portfolio, including:
Technical performance and degradation characteristics
Safety and intrinsic hazards
Supply chain readiness and scalability
Levelized cost of energy (LCOE)
Develop and lead stage-gate processes for New Energy Systems, advancing technologies and products from TRL 4–8 and MRL 4–8
Define technical criteria and lead system architecture design, including integration with:
Renewable generation (solar, wind)
Grid interconnection and microgrids
Energy management systems (EMS) and SCADA
Support project development and execution, including:
Conceptual and detailed design
Equipment specification and vendor selection
Integration with EPC and construction teams
Ensure compliance with applicable codes and standards
Lead development of product documentation, including:
Design basis and system specifications
Installation and commissioning procedures
Operations & maintenance manuals
Collaborate with supply chain and manufacturing teams to industrialize hydrogen and fuel cell systems
Support funding and partnerships, including grants (DOE, CEC), strategic partnerships, and pilot projects
Provide technical support to commercial deployments to ensure performance, reliability, and continuous improvement
Foster a culture of technical excellence, innovation, accountability, and collaboration across multidisciplinary teams
